desirous casino dealers can get their blackjack dealer lessons through various gaming schools in the U.S. that employ licensed instructors to teach gaming routines. Quite a few students customarily pick only oneor two games to specialize in, and understand the particulars of that game.

Many casino schools provide manageable schedules, and repeatedly provide day or evening trainings dependent on the demands of the students. Admission amount for blackjack dealer studies are contingent on the length of the class and game procedures taught. The cost may vary from $500 in cash for a short session to $2,000 or more for extended craps training.

Despite the fact that there are no enlisting requirements for blackjack dealer training, some states have their own rules and regulations. For instance, in Nevada enrollees need to be at least twenty one years old by the appointed time they are scheduled to graduate from the dealer school. Correspondingly, New Jersey dealing schools also follow the twenty-one-year age guidelines. So, it is credible to inquire about the age requirements before signing up into gaming schools. You can search online to find professional dealing schools in your neighborhood, and you can contact these schools directly to attain information about the assorted courses tendered and their course fees.

Lots of blackjack dealing courses cover all aspects of dealing and additionally offer heightened courses in poker and craps. Some gaming schools create an ambiance similar to that of a real casino by using definitive tables, chips, and other professional equipment commonly utilized in the casino gambling industry.

Learning blackjack dealing from a wagering school is not definitely required, as casinos at no time originally require you to attend a private dealer school. Regardless, these courses help students gain insight and expertise to be employed in a casino, and managers in many instances prefer to hire someone capable of dealing in a sophisticated manner.

Three Online Black jack Tricks

While it might only require a number of mins to pickup vingt-et-un, it can likely take a whole lot longer to become versed in the nuances of the game. Online vingt-et-un is close to 21 at real world gambling halls, but there are a few differences.

Below are 3 fantastic internet chemin de fer tips that should assist you in playing wiser and win greater profit.

Web Chemin de fer Tip One

The first pointer I will give anybody that’s going to gamble on online 21 is to never be concerned about counting cards. In actuality, if you are looking to gamble on internet vingt-et-un all of the time, don’t even spend effort learning card counting, on the grounds that it will not assist you.

Many online blackjack rounds are dealt from a deck that is mixed up just before each deal. as long as this is the situation, counting cards won’t help you. Even if the online blackjack casino relies on a more customary concept, you cannot effectively count cards if you don’t know when the cards are about to be mixed up and how much of the deck is left up until that time.

Web Black jack Hint Two

Keep apart from cheap tricks. Since internet gambling halls only use virtual room, they will be able to experiment with all sorts of match options. The majority of varieties of established chemin de fer are just carnivalesque matches. They will be enjoyable to look at and wager on at times, but you will be throwing way bills.

Online 21 Tip Three

Web blackjack casino games use a random number generator (RNG) to determine what cards should be dealt. The game is highly arbitrary and subject to streaks-great or detrimental. At no time accept that you are "due" to win.

You must continuously wager methodically and never bow to to bad runs. They’re bound to develop in net 21, exactly like in the actual world. Either stop betting or gamble with adequate bankroll to ride out the barrage.

Net black jack might be exciting and relaxing. It is close to the brick and mortar version, although it does have a few subtle variations. Once you see this, you are in a better position to earn money.

Master chemin de fer Card Counting and Break the Croupier!

21 is one of the scant games in which you can get an edge on the gambling hall.

This is a trick that you will be able to master and profit from rapidly and effortlessly.

Before you learn to count cards however, you need to be adept with twenty-one basic strategy, the system that many card-counting methods are built on.

Here we will familiarize you to how counting cards works and eliminate quite a few established misconceptions.

Card Counting Misconceptions

Before we begin lets dispel two common myths with regard to counting cards:

1. Card counters don’t remember every card they have seen being dealt out of a deck or shoe, and card counting does NOT have to be complex.

In fact, simple schemes often are extremely effectual. It is the rationale the scheme is founded upon, NOT its complexity that makes a system successful.

2. Counting cards also doesn’t allow a gambler to discern with certainty what cards will be dealt out the deck next.

Card counting is actually a calculation theory NOT a predictive theory.

While it puts the expectations in your favor over the long term, short-term bad luck segments happen for most players, so be prepared!

1. Why card counting works

People who play smart chemin de fer scheme with a counting cards system can best the gambling dens edge.

The reasoning behind this is basic. Small value cards favour the casino in vingt-et-un, and big cards aid the gambler.

Small cards favour the croupier because they help them make winning totals on her hands when the dealer is stiff, (has a 12, 13, 14, 15, or 16 total on her first 2 cards).

2. Counting Cards Your Benefit over the Casino

In casino 21, you can stay on your stiffs if you choose to, but the croupier can’t. They has no decision to make but you do, and in this is your benefit.

Rules of the game require that they hit her stiffs no matter how rich the shoe is in big cards that will break her.

3. Card Counting Increasing The Odds Of Hitting 21

The big value cards help the gambler not only because they may bust the croupier when he takes a card on his stiffs, but because the 10 value cards and Aces create blackjacks.

Though blackjacks are of course, equally allocated between the casino and the gambler, the important fact is that the gambler is paid-out more (three to two) when he is dealt a blackjack.

4. You Don’t Need To Count All the Cards

When card counting, you do not have to count the amounts of all of the specific card values in order to understand when you have an benefit over the casino.

You only need to realize when the deck is rich or poor in high cards i.e the cards are beneficial to the player.

5. Card Counting – You Need To Act On Your Advantage!

Counting cards on its own can disclose when you have an benefit, but to pump up your bankroll you will want to change your wager size up when you have an edge and lower when you do not.

For counting cards, to be effectual you need to ACT and exploit on the opportunities that are favorable to you.

Playing 21 — to Win

[ English ]

If you like the thrill and excitement of a perfect card game and the excitement of winning and acquiring some cash with the odds in your favour, gambling on Blackjack is for you.

So, how can you beat the dealer?

Quite simply when betting on vingt-et-un you are observing the risks and chances of the cards in relation to:

1. The cards in your hand

2. What cards could be dealt from the deck

When wagering on chemin de fer there is statistically a best way to play each hand and this is referred to as basic strategy. If you add card counting that helps you calculate the odds of cards being dealt from the deck, then you can boost your action amount when the odds are in your favor and decrease them when the edge is not.

You’re only going to succeed at under half the hands you bet on, so it is important that you adjust action size when the odds are in your favor.

To do this when wagering on blackjack you have to use basic strategy and card counting to win.

Basic tactics and counting cards

Since professionals and academics have been studying twenty-one all sorts of abstract plans have been developed, including "counting cards" but even though the theory is complicated counting cards is all in all very easy when you play 21.

If when betting on twenty-one you card count reliably (even if the game uses more than one deck), you can change the odds to your favor.

Chemin de fer Basic Strategy

Twenty-one basic strategy is centralized around a basic plan of how you bet depending upon the hand you are dealt and is mathematically the best hand to play while not counting cards. It informs you when wagering on twenty-one when you should hit or stand.

It is remarkably easy to do and is soon memorized and until then you can find complimentary guides on the net

Using it when you wager on 21 will bring down the casino’s expectations to near to even.

Counting cards tilting the edge in your favor

Card counting works and gamblers use a card counting approach achieve an advantage over the gambling hall.

The reason this is simple.

Low cards favour the dealer in 21 and high cards favour the gambler.

Low cards favour the house because they assist them acquire winning totals on their hands when she is stiff (has a twelve, thirteen, fourteen, fifteen, or 16 total on their 1st two cards).

In casino chemin de fer, you can hold on your stiffs if you want to, but the dealer can’t.

The house has no decision to make, but you do and this is your edge. The rules of wagering on 21 require that croupiers hit stiffs no matter how loaded the deck is in high cards that will bust her.

The high cards favour the player because they may break the dealer when she hits her stiffs and also blackjacks are made with aces and tens.

Despite the fact blackjacks are, evenly dispersed between the casino and the gambler, the fact is that the gambler gets paid more (3:2) when she receives a blackjack so the player has an advantage.

You don’t have to compute the numbers of each of the individual card to know when you have an advantage over the croupier.

You only need to know when the deck is flush or reduced in high cards and you can boost your bet when the expectation is in your favour.

This is a simple account of why card-counting plans work, but gives you an understanding into why the logic works.

When betting on vingt-et-un over an extended time card counting will help in changing the odds in your favour by approx two percent.
